President shines at Lower Murray & Hills Vets’ Golf Day

Sixty members of the Lower Murray & Hills Veteran Golfers’ Association travelled to Murray Bridge for their monthly game on Monday 17th October. The players made the most of the beautiful Spring weather and good course conditions, but it was an extra special day for President Colin Stevens, who was the overall winner.

“I finally had a good game, winning an Eftpos card valued at $50 with the sponsorship funds provided by Living Choice,” he said.

“Lots of prizes were given out, including Living Choice golf towels with every prize,” he added.

Colin scored 38 Stableford points to be the overall winner. The Division 1 winner was Steve Nailer with 37 points and the placings were all decided on a countback. Second was Jill Sommerlad with 36 points, third was Ian Bristow with 36 points and in fourth place was Graham Young with 36 points.
